Because the ankle is small, ankle tattoos usually are, too. Flowers, hearts, small kanji symbols, dolphins and shooting stars are popular, and for good reason - they are ageless symbols of beauty, friendship, love, and the miracle of life. You won't have to explain them. Tattoos for younger girls include butterflies and fairies. Vines and other flowing motifs suit the ankle, as well, and often circle the ankle in a band or bracelet design. Kanji characters, monograms, short text tattoo (in any language), or a tribal icon have all proven to effectively celebrate that most sexy of all female parts - the leg.

Speaking of which, the ankle tattoo design is not the most painless part of the
body on which to be tattooed. Quite the opposite, in fact. There's
very little fat on the ankle, essentially just skin stretched over
bone. The less tissue between the needle and the bone, the more
painful the tattooing process is. Therefore, the higher up on the
ankle tatoo, the less painful the experience will be. Remember, too, that
our extremities bleed more profusely, so be prepared to elevate the
leg as it heals, so as to combat any swelling or bleeding that might
occur.
Remember, too, that you're generally paying less for an ankle
tattoo. Since ankle tattoos are relatively small, the tattooist
won't take as long to ink it, so they're relatively inexpensive as
body art goes, which suits a first tattoo. A word to the wise,
however. Money spent to design something unique is money well spent.
The more personally significant the tattoo is to the individual
(even if the tattoo is small), the more assurance you'll have that
it will continue to charm you into old age.
Summer is the best season to get your ankle tattoo. The less
clothing coming into contact with the freshly inked design, the
better. Because ankle tattoos are close to the ground, special care
must be taken to ensure that the tattoo is kept clean and
disinfected as it heals.
